L_VAL
Краткое описание :
Обновление курса валют. Увеличить кол-во знаков в дробной
части.Описание :
Обновление курсов валютЧто измененно :
Обновление курса валют. Увеличить кол-во знаков в дробной части
с 4 до 8.
Поле CURSVAL.SUMRUBL имеет точность в 8 знаков после запятой.
Ввести вручную курс валют с 8 знаками после запятой в Галактике можно.
Ресурсы, которые позволяют закачивать курсы валют (pfsoft.com.ua, cbr.ru,
nbrb.by)
предоставляют их с 4мя знаками после запятой. Но номинал может быть 1, 10, 100,
1000.
При импорте в Галактику таких курсов, с предварительным преобразованием к
номиналу в 1
мы теряем цифры в дробной части.
Например,
На 01/11/2011 Курс евро составляет 1116,8598 грн за 100 ЕВРО, что
соответственно будет 11,168598 за 1 ЕВРО.
Поскольку у нас в Галактике курс указывается за 1 ЕВРО, а не за 100, то
соответственно и курс должен
быть 11,168598,а не 11,1685.
Предполагаю, что для реализации этой задачи достаточно в getcurval.vip
изменить округление в строках вида
CursVal.SumRubl := Round(CursVal.SumRubl, 4);
Как измененно :
При импорте курс округляется до 4-х знаков после запятой.
Если курс устанавливается не за одну единицу, а за 10, 100, 1000 и т.д.
точность округления увеличивается соответственно на 1, 2, 3 и т.д. единицы.
Т.е. есть курс за 100 евро, то курс округлится до 6-ти знаков после запятой
L_VAL
Краткое описание :
Код и наименование российского рубляОписание :
Курсы валютЧто измененно :
Код и наименование российского рубля
В каталоге валют неверно выводится код и наименование российского рубля.
В настоящий момент краткое наименование RUB код 643. Просим внести изменения.
Согласно международному стандарту по обозначению валют (ISO 4217) для
современного российского рубля:
1) Трёхбуквенный код: RUB
2) Трёхзначный числовой код: 643
До деноминации российского рубля в 1998 году в том же стандарте для российского
рубля использовались коды:
1) Трёхбуквенный код: RUR
2) Трёхзначный числовой код: 810
Сейчас эти обозначения уже неверны (точнее, верны, но только для обозначения
старых неденоминированных рублей до 1998 года).
Добавить новый код.
Как измененно :
При добавлении в каталог российского рубля будет новый код 643
и обозначение RUB.
Для существующей записи потребуется вручную поменять. В т.ч. если рос. руб
национальная валюта - поменять значения в настройке национальной валюты
L_VAL
Краткое описание :
Необходимо упростить обновление курсов валют.Описание :
Курсы валют (*)Что измененно :
Необходимо упросить обновление курсов валют.
Клиент просит сделать либо автоматом обновление при
первом входе в систему, либо нажатием одной кнопки по
предустановленным настройкам. Т.к. обновляют каждый
день, процесс превращается в рутину.
Как измененно :
Добавлена новая системная настройка "Настройки Галактики \ Общие настройки системы \ Автоматическое обновление курсов валют"
При значении настройки ДА будет происходить автоматическое обновление курсов валют на текущую дату при первом запуске Галактики каким-либо пользователем системы.
Т.е. автоматическое обновление курсов валют возможно только один раз в день. При этом у того пользователя, который первый в данные сутки запустил Галактику будет выдан протокол обновления - период, источник и ошибки, если имели место
Также несколько улучшена эргономика интерфейса, более адекватным и удобным стали наборы кнопок по соответствующим закладкам. Локальное меню удалено за ненадобностью и дублированием функционала
L_VAL
Краткое описание :
Ломается представление каталога курсов валют при удалении
"прогнозных" курсовОписание :
Курсы валютЧто измененно :
Ломается представление каталога курсов валют (левая панель) при
удалении "прогнозных" курсов,
см. вложение.
Как измененно :
Исправлено.
Если прогнозных курсов нет, то и папка не светится.